Ancient fire pits were sometimes built in the ground, within caves, or in the center of a hut or home. Evidence of prehistoric, man-made fires is present on all five inhabited continents. The disadvantage of early indoor fire pits was that they generated toxic and/or irritating smoke within the house.Fire pits developed into elevated hearths in structures, but ventilation smoke depended on open windows or holes in roofs. The medieval great hall typically needed a centrally located hearth, where an open flame burnt with all the smoke climbing into the port in the roof. Louvers were developed during the Middle Ages to allow the roof vents to be covered so rain and snow wouldn't enter.

Also throughout the Middle Ages, smoke canopies were devised to stop smoke from spreading through an area and vent it out through a ceiling or wall. These can be placed against rock walls, instead of taking up the center of the room, and this allowed smaller chambers to be warmed.Chimneys were devised in northern Europe in the 11th or 12th centuries and largely fixed the issue of fumes, more reliably venting smoke out. They made it feasible to provide the fireplace a draft, and also made it feasible to place fireplaces in numerous rooms in buildings handily. They didn't come into general usage immediately, however, as they were more expensive to build and maintain.

The 18th century saw two major developments in the history of fireplaces. Benjamin Franklin developed a convection chamber for the fireplace which greatly improved the efficiency of fireplaces and wood stoves. In addition, he enhanced the airflow by pulling air from a basement and venting a longer area at the very top. In the later 18th century, Count Rumford made a fireplace with a tall, shallow firebox which has been better at drawing up the smoke and out of the construction. The shallow design also improved greatly the quantity of radiant warmth projected to the space. Rumford's design is the basis for modern fireplaces.

The Aesthetic movement of the 1870s and 1880s took to a more traditional spectra based on rock and also deflected unnecessary ornamentation. Rather it relied on simple layouts with little unnecessary ornamentation. From the 1890s the Aesthetic movement gave way to the Arts and Crafts movement, in which the emphasis was still placed on supplying quality stone. Stone fireplaces at this time were a sign of wealth, which to a degree is still the notion today.A fireplace is a construction made of brick, stone or metal made to contain a fire. Fireplaces are used for the relaxing ambiance they create and also for heating a room. Modern fireplaces vary in heat efficacy, depending upon the plan.

Historically they have been utilized for heating a dwelling, cooking, and heating water for laundry and domestic uses. A fireplace might have the following: a base, a hearth, a firebox, a mantelpiece; a chimney (utilized in laundry and kitchen fireplaces), a grate, a lintel, a lintel pub, home overmantel, a damper, a smoke room, a neck, a flue, and a chimney filter or afterburner.

On the exterior there's frequently a corbeled brick crown, where the projecting courses of brick function as a drip route to keep rainwater from running down the exterior walls. A cap, hood, or shroud functions to keep rainwater out of the exterior of the chimney; rain in the chimney is a far greater problem in chimneys lined with impervious flue tiles or metal liners than with the standard masonry chimney, which soaks up all but the most violent rain. Some chimneys have a spark arrestor incorporated into the crown or cap.

Kinds of fireplacesManufactured fireplaces are made with sheet metal or glass fire boxes.Electric fireplaces can be built-in replacements for wood or gas or retrofit with log inserts or electrical fireboxes.A few types are, wall mounted electric fireplaces, electric fireplace stoves, electrical mantel fireplaces and fixed or free standing electric fireplaces.

Ventless Fireplaces (duct free/room-venting fireplaces) are fueled by gel, liquid propane, bottled gas or natural gas. In the United States, several states and local businesses have laws limiting these types of fireplaces. They need to be suitably sized to the area to be heated. There are also air quality management problems due to the quantity of moisture that they discharge in the room air, and oxygen detector and carbon monoxide sensors are safety essentials. Direct vent fireplaces are fueled by liquid propane or natural gas. They are completely sealed from the place that's heated, and port all exhaust gasses into the exterior of the structure.

AccessoriesFor the inside, common in current Western cultures comprise grates, fireguards, log boxes, andirons, pellet baskets, along with fire puppies, all of which cradle fuel and accelerate burning. A grate (or fire grate) is a frame, usually of iron bars, to maintain fuel for a fire. Heavy metallic firebacks are sometimes utilized to catch and re-radiate heat, to safeguard the rear of the fireplace, and as decoration. Fenders are low metal frames placed before the fireplace to contain embers, soot and ash. For fireplace tending, tools include pokers, bellows, tongs, shovels, brushes and instrument racks. Other wider accessories can include log baskets, companion sets, coal buckets, cabinet accessories and more.

As time passes, the purpose of fireplaces has transformed from one of necessity to one of visual interest. Early ones were fire pits than contemporary fireplaces. They were used for heat on chilly days and nights, in addition to for cooking. They also served as a gathering place inside the home. These fire pits were generally centered within a space, allowing more individuals to collect around it.

Many flaws were found in early fireplace designs. Along with the Industrial Revolution, came large scale housing developments, requiring a standardization of fireplaces. The most renowned fireplace designers of the time were the Adam Brothers. They perfected a style of fireplace design that has been used for generations. It was smaller, more brightly colored, with a emphasis on the level of the substances used in their construction, instead of their size.

From the 1800s newest fireplaces were composed of two components, the surround and the add. The encircle consisted of the mantlepiece and sides supports, usually in wood, marble or granite. The insert was where the fire burnt, and was constructed of cast iron often backed with ornamental tiles. In addition to providing warmth, the fireplaces of the Victorian age were thought to add a cozy ambiance into homes.

Some fireplace units incorporate a blower which transfers more of the fireplace's heat to the air via convection, resulting in a more evenly heated area and a lower heating load. Fireplace efficiency can also be enhanced by means of a fireback, a sheet of metal which sits behind the flame and reflects heat back into the room. Firebacks are traditionally made from cast iron, but can also be manufactured from stainless steel. Efficiency is a complex concept although with open hearth fireplaces. Most efficacy tests consider just the impact of heating of the atmosphere. An open fireplace isn't, and never was, intended to heat the atmosphere. A fireplace with a fireback is a radiant heater, and has done so since the 15th century. The ideal method to gauge the output signal of a fireplace is if you detect you're turning the thermostat up or down.

Most older fireplaces have a relatively low efficiency score. Standard, contemporary, weatherproof masonry fireplaces though have an efficiency rating of at least 80% (legal minimum requirement for example in Salzburg/Austria). To improve efficiency, fireplaces may also be modified by adding special heavy fireboxes designed to burn cleaner and can reach efficiencies as large as 80% in heating the atmosphere. These modified fireplaces are usually equipped with a large fire window, enabling an efficient heating process in two phases. During the first phase the first heat is offered through a big glass window while the fire is burning. During this time period the construction, constructed of refractory bricks, absorbs the warmth. This heat is then equally radiated for many hours during the second stage. Masonry fireplaces without a glass fire window just offer heat radiated from the surface.
